The capital's air defense forces continue to repel a massive attack by unmanned aerial vehicles. According to the latest data, 123 drones have already been destroyed, as reported by Moscow Mayor Sergei Sobyanin on his Telegram channel.

The mayor also noted that emergency services specialists are working at the sites where debris fell.

In response to the enemy's actions, Russian military forces are striking decision-making centers, enterprises, and warehouses used by the Armed Forces of Ukraine together with NATO specialists. For this purpose, strike drones and long-range precision weapons capable of hitting targets both in Kyiv and across the entire territory of Ukraine are being used.
